Output 6c69160c3148978bfd1a3ab35f6aa39fadbe3f5eb6032db1978bd2fc85259228:0

value
638870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ec35ed075ab40c368d5eaad3197e6a2747b8cd23 OP_EQUAL
address
3PDyzeoFjtiBJJ8VdQ7Tirffq6wPSmwCBh
transaction
6c69160c3148978bfd1a3ab35f6aa39fadbe3f5eb6032db1978bd2fc85259228
confirmations
4062
spent
true